Oh no! I do this often. What I learned helps is to make a new text document on the desktop, and write it all on there. That way, if you accidentally close the browser you still have the post you were trying to make.

That wasn't the end of my problems yesterday. I then spent the best part of two hours customising a house for a couple of Sims to move into, and, when I went back to Neighbourhood View, the house wasn't there at all. I feel I should have been aware of this problem, because it has happened to me before, but it was a good few years ago.

The Maxis base game Ranch Retreat is possibly my favourite Maxis house. With a price tag under §11K, it is well within the reach of families just out of CAS, and it has two decent sized bedrooms, so it will comfortably sleep a family of four, even without any alteration. So I sometimes use it as the basis for further development. Anyway I wanted a slightly bigger version of it, with at least three double bedrooms, a second bathroom, because all my Sims entertain a lot, and toilet queues are often a problem after meals. I wanted a design that I wanted to reuse (usually tweaked a bit every time I use it). So instead of building it in situ in Baldrair Bluffs, the 'hood I'm currently playing, I built it in Aedicia, my Simless building 'hood. When I'd finished it to about the same condition as the Maxis original (plumbing, kitchen counters, bathroom fittings, plus basic lighting -- which I think is missing in the original!), I saved it to the lot bin. I then placed a copy of it back where I'd just taken it from. Then I opened Baldrair Bluffs, took my new house from the lot bin, placed it on a corner site on low lying ground a little bit back from the north bank of the river, and started editing it. A couple of hours later, I had it more or less how I wanted it, so I saved it, and went back to Neighbourhood View, and my new lot was nowhere to be seen!! Well, it was still in the Lot Bin, but it wasn't in the the Neighbourhood at all!

This really shouldn't have surprised me, because the same thing happened nearly ten years ago, when I was developing New Desconia. I made a house (also based on the Ranch Retreat -- this time squeezed into a 2x1 lot) in Aedicia, then as now my Sim-free building 'hood, and then copied it to New Desconia via the Lot Bin. Like yesterday, I edited it for a while, only to find when I saved it, that it wasn't there after all. The solution (or at least a workaround) is to quit the game and restart it. I did that ten years ago, and I did it again yesterday. But of course on both occasions I had to redo all the work I'd just done. When I finished yesterday, I immediately moved my Sims in and started to play. I played them for four Sim Days, saving and restarting several times, without any problems, so I have every confidence now that their house is now here to stay. By the way, the one in New Desconia that I remade in the same way ten years ago is still OK. I was playing it earlier this year, and the Sim who lives there is still doing fine. When I was setting up Riverbreeze, I accidentally left SimPE open while launching the game. This resulted in putting down a house and having it disappear when I went back to neighbourhood. I ended up deleting and restarting (I hadn't done much aside from picking out the terrain, thankfully).
